Peter Laviolette Fired as New York Rangers Head Coach After Disappointing Season

- 🎯 The New York Rangers have fired head coach Peter Laviolette following a season of disappointment and failure to make the playoffs.
- 📉 This decision comes after a year where the team, which had the best record in hockey the previous season, saw a significant downturn.
Unmet Expectations and Roster Issues
- 💡 Despite Peter Laviolette's strong coaching pedigree, including the most wins by an American coach in history, he couldn't overcome unmet expectations.
- ⚠️ Last season, Laviolette led the Rangers to a franchise-best record and reached the Stanley Cup Final, but this season things fell apart.
- 🧩 GM Chris Drury's trades, including the team captain, are cited as moves that gutted the roster and contributed to the team's struggles.
Coaching Market Impact
- ⚡ The availability of a coach with Laviolette's experience is expected to impact the current five head coaching openings in the NHL.
- 📈 His availability might prompt other teams to re-evaluate and potentially open up their coaching searches.
